Gonna do my write up here to discuss a 2011 release and that was the highly anticipated return of Morbid Angel one of the pioneers of death metal, they have Covenant the best selling death metal album of all time.
It was 8 years since their previous record and that was Heretic which was a terrible record in itself.

Now another thing to note during the 8 year gap is Steve Tucker was to leave the band after Heretic, David Vincent would return in 2004 and do tours, but this was to be the first release with him on vocals since Domination in 1995 so naturally I was excited for this release having seen the band live prior to the release. Also with Pete Sandoval having back surgery, the drum duties went to Tim Yeung.
Ill be brutally honest as I have before, this album was a huge huge disappointment, I believe bands should be able to experiment but this one was one of those that was a complete flop. The band decided to do some parts industrial, some fruity loop drums and dance techno blast beats, also rap style tag line lyrics feature heavily in songs such as Destructos, Radikult ( the worst death metal song of all time), Too Extreme and Profundis Mea Culpa.
Being this was an album that was the return of a band on a huge hiatus between albums, this is something that probably should have had more of their core trademark death sound, the songs on this I think did have some elements of their old sound and I do like are Existo, Nevermore, Blades For Baal, those tracks packed riffing which I could easily recognize Morbid Angel. But with the more experimental tracks and I believe experimenting should involve some part of the core or trademark sound of the band , none of these other songs are memorable, nor are they the least bit enjoyable.
To really put it simply, I do not recommend anyone who is a death metal fan expecting the old Morbid Angel to buy this record, it is the worst album put out in 2011, it is the St Anger of Death Metal and Morbid Angel. It will disappoint more then anything.
